When can I start working?
According to the legislation of the Republic of Poland, foreign citizens and stateless persons must obtain permission to perform work before employment. The processing time for this permit is approximately 15 (fifteen) days.
-
Can I start work if I do not have a work permit?
No! You do not have the right to start work without this permit in hand. Otherwise, according to the legislation of the Republic of Poland, you will be deported from the country, with a ban on the right to cross the borders of the Schengen zone for a period of 5 (five) years.
